>  기사  >  Java  >  Java의 정적 코드 블록의 특징은 무엇입니까?

Java의 정적 코드 블록의 특징은 무엇입니까?

王林
王林앞으로
2020-07-09 17:40:123630검색

Java의 정적 코드 블록의 특징은 무엇입니까?

정적 코드 블록:

(추천 튜토리얼: java 입문 프로그램)

정적 코드 블록은 static{}으로 래핑된 코드 블록을 말하며, 정적 코드는 한 번만 실행되므로 Class를 전달할 수 있습니다. forName(" classPath")는 코드의 정적 코드 블록을 깨우고 한 번 실행하기도 합니다.

형식:

static{
}

특징:

  • 클래스가 로드될 때 실행되고 한 번만 실행되며 기본 기능보다 우선합니다.

  • 은 클래스를 초기화하는 데 사용됩니다.

  • 클래스는 여러 정적 코드 블록을 작성할 수 있습니다.

  • null을 가리키는 참조 변수를 생성하면 정적 코드 블록이 트리거되지 않습니다.

(동영상 튜토리얼 추천: java 동영상 튜토리얼)

예:

public class HelloA {    
    static{
        System.out.println("I'm A static code block");
    }
}

위 내용은 Java의 정적 코드 블록의 특징은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
이 기사는 cnblogs.com에서 복제됩니다. 침해가 있는 경우 admin@php.cn으로 문의하시기 바랍니다. 삭제